Freezer Lime Daiquiris

Nothing says summertime like a cold, refreshing lime daiquiri from the freezer. This classic cocktail is the perfect balance of sweet and tart and is a great way to beat the heat.


serves/makes:
  
ready in:
  over 5 hrs

ingredients

2 cans (6 ounce size) frozen limeade concentrate, thawed, undiluted
1 can (6 ounce size) frozen lemonade concentrate, thawed, undiluted
4 1/2 cups rum
4 1/2 cups water
lime slices

directions

Combine the limeade, lemonade, rum, and water in a freezer-proof container. Cover the container and place in the freezer for 12-24 hours.

When ready to make the daiquiris, scoop out 4 cups of the frozen mixture and place in a blender. Process until slushy. Transfer to individual cocktail glasses. Garnish with lime slices and serve immediately. Repeat with the remaining mixture as needed.

Keep the daiquiri mixture frozen when not using. It will keep in the freezer for 2-3 weeks if kept airtight.
